چکیده

Realistic face modeling and animation is a challenging topic in computer graphics. In this paper, we develop an approach to create realistic human face with minimum user interaction. The face created is animatable and MPEG-4 compatible. The system takes cylinder mapped texture image and sparse or dense range data, which can be obtained from any available resources, as input. After locating 11 major feature points in the texture image, an automatic feature locating method is applied to get all feature positions. Then the multi-step compactly supported radial basis function (RBF) is used to automatically adapt from a generic face model to a specific face model. If dense range data are available, the face model is refined by Triangular B-spline which takes the RBF adapted face model as its initial value. After that automatic texture mapping is used to obtain a realistic face.
